Beneil Dariush explains why he’s not “ashamed” with his TKO loss to Charles Oliveira at UFC 289
Cole Shelton - June 16, 2023
Beneil Dariush isn’t upset with his UFC 289 performance. Dariush was taking on Charles Oliveira in the co-main event of the pay-per-view card and if Dariush won, he would have gotten a lightweight title shot. However, after some early success, Oliveira caught him with a head kick and then landed several punches which hurt Dariush. Once he shot for a takedown, Oliveira got on top of him and scored a first-round TKO.

Chris Weidman confident he will make fans believe he’s a legit threat to UFC champion Israel Adesanya with comeback fight
Harry Kettle - June 16, 2023
Former UFC champion Chris Weidman believes he can make fans believe that he’s a threat to Israel Adesanya in his next outing. It’s been over two years since we last saw Chris Weidman compete inside the Octagon. When he did, the former middleweight king broke his leg in a nasty way when battling Uriah Hall. Ever since then, he’s been fighting to get back in the cage – and it seems as if he’s ready to do just that.
